引言随着互联网的快速发展,网页动效已成为提升用户体验的重要手段。jQuery作为一款广泛使用的JavaScript库,极大地简化了网页动效的开发过程。本文将深入探讨jQuery的引入技巧,帮助开发者轻...
随着互联网的快速发展,网页动效已成为提升用户体验的重要手段。jQuery作为一款广泛使用的JavaScript库,极大地简化了网页动效的开发过程。本文将深入探讨jQuery的引入技巧,帮助开发者轻松掌握网页动效加速的秘籍。
jQuery是一个快速、小型且功能丰富的JavaScript库。它通过简洁的API封装了大量的DOM操作、事件处理、动画效果等功能,使得JavaScript的开发变得更为简单和高效。
CDN(内容分发网络)是一种将内容存储在多个地理位置的服务器上,以加速内容加载的技术。以下是使用CDN引入jQuery的示例代码:
如果你希望将jQuery库存储在本地服务器上,可以通过以下方式引入:
确保将path/to/jquery.min.js替换为jQuery库的实际路径。
jQuery提供了丰富的选择器,可以方便地选择DOM元素。以下是一些常用的选择器示例:
// 选择id为myElement的元素
$('#myElement');
// 选择class为myClass的元素
$('.myClass');
// 选择所有p元素
$('p');jQuery提供了简单的事件处理机制。以下是一个点击事件的示例:
$('#myElement').click(function() { alert('Hello, jQuery!');
});jQuery的动画功能非常强大,可以实现各种复杂的动画效果。以下是一个简单的淡入动画示例:
$('#myElement').fadeIn(1000);频繁的DOM操作会导致浏览器性能下降。在开发过程中,尽量减少DOM操作,可以使用缓存、批处理等方法优化。
CSS3动画具有更好的性能,可以减少JavaScript的负担。以下是一个使用CSS3动画的示例:
将jQuery库缓存到浏览器中,可以减少重复加载的时间。可以使用浏览器缓存插件或手动添加缓存指令。
本文介绍了jQuery的引入技巧,并通过实际案例展示了其基本使用方法。通过掌握这些技巧,开发者可以轻松实现网页动效,提升用户体验。同时,优化网页动效的方法也有助于提高网站性能。希望本文能对开发者有所帮助。